Across TCGA patient cohorts, NBPF20 mutation is significantly associated with the RNA expression of many other genes, with 17 significant associations in total. COAD shows the largest number of these associations.

The most reproducible NBPF20-associated genes across cancer lineages are RN7SL598P, MRPS21P5, and TOMM22P3. Each is linked with NBPF20 in more than 1 cancer types. Because this analysis shows association rather than direction, both NBPF20-to-partner and partner-to-NBPF20 results are reported.
